Donald Trump's 'Board of Peace' for Gaza: Who Could Be on It
Summary
President Donald Trump plans to create a "Board of Peace" to oversee Gaza's reconstruction and governance following a ceasefire. This board is part of a larger plan to end conflict in Gaza and includes international figures, although members have not been officially confirmed. The board will work with a Palestinian committee to manage Gaza's day-to-day operations.Key Facts
- President Trump announced a plan named the "Board of Peace" to oversee Gaza's transition after a ceasefire.
- The board will handle Gaza's reconstruction and governance with a Palestinian technocratic committee.
- Trump will chair the board, with discussions on who else will join, including Nickolay Mladenov and Tony Blair.
- Phase Two of Trump's plan follows a ceasefire that involved Israel and Hamas stopping fighting and allowing aid into Gaza.
- The U.N. highlights ongoing humanitarian needs in Gaza, and the board's role is politically significant.
- Reports mention potential board members from various countries, but no official lineup is confirmed.
- The ceasefire plan includes efforts to disarm Hamas and establish technocratic governance.
